Navigating the Permanent Shift in Federal Tax Laws



The start of 2026 marks a major landmark for company owner since numerous tax stipulations that were formerly short-lived have now come to be long-term. This modification provides a degree of predictability that York business owners have not seen in years. One of the most considerable updates includes the remediation of 100% bonus offer devaluation. If you purchased new equipment for a local production shop or updated the innovation in your midtown office during the previous year, you can currently subtract the complete cost in a solitary tax obligation duration. This is a powerful tool for handling cash flow, especially as you look to reinvest in your operations.



Past devices, the policies bordering the Qualified Business Income reduction have actually additionally gotten to a state of durability. For most of our neighborhood company and merchants, this 20% deduction stays a keystone of minimizing total tax responsibility. The reporting limits for kinds like the 1099-NEC have likewise been adjusted upward to 2,000 dollars. While this could decrease the overall variety of kinds you require to send by mail out to service providers, it does not change the demand for immaculate recordkeeping. Ensuring your books are well balanced well prior to the April due date permits you to claim every available credit scores without the stress and anxiety of last-minute corrections.



Pennsylvania State Tax Reforms and Local Opportunities



Pennsylvania has introduced several business-friendly reforms that particularly benefit the diverse economy of York County. The state is proceeding its multi-year phase-down of the Corporate Net Income Tax, which goes down to 7.49% for the 2026 tax obligation year. This steady decrease is made to make the Commonwealth more affordable and supplies a direct boost to the bottom line of bundled organizations. In addition, the state has improved the therapy of Net Operating Losses. Small companies can now subtract a bigger percentage of previous losses against current revenues, which is particularly helpful for start-ups or organizations that saw ever-changing income throughout recent economic changes.

Managing your schedule is equally as crucial as handling your cash during the 2026 tax season. Due to the fact that March 15 falls on a Sunday this year, the declaring target date for collaborations and S-corporations has actually transferred to Monday, March 16. If your organization is structured as a C-corporation or a single proprietorship, your target date remains April 15. Maintaining these days in mind is critical since the charges for late declaring have actually raised, and they are frequently determined per shareholder or partner. Even if you intend to declare an expansion, you must still estimate and pay any type of taxes owed by the initial due date to avoid interest costs.



It is additionally vital to keep in mind that York business owners must remain certified with regional tax obligation demands, consisting of the business benefit and mercantile tax obligations mandated by particular municipalities.
